Yes. I turn the LED off to mist them. I spray with the same solution that I water with. I’m reconsidering this because of the soil pH.

I’m thinking I should have a separate solution for the foliar spray pH’d in the proper 6.5 - 7.0 range. The soil needs it to be lower, but after thinking about it, the leaves shouldn’t.

The runoff ranged 6.7-6.9 on pH. TDS ranged 101-137. I know what the pH is telling me…soil levels are ok except for the two that were at 6.9. I can live with that.

I’m not sure what the runoff TDS is supposed to be telling me. I know the difference between the two numbers is what remains in the soil, but what am I supposed to do with that information? @Majiktoker?
